Comiskey Center (Fine Arts)
Comiskey Center (Fine Arts) is a school building in Town of Goffstown, Hillsborough County, New Hampshire. Comiskey Center (Fine Arts) is situated nearby to Roy Park, as well as near the sports venue Stoutenburgh Gymnasium.Places of Interest Nearby

Ste. Marie Church
Church
Photo: Faolin42, CC BY-SA 3.0.
Ste. Marie Church is a Roman Catholic church on the West Side of Manchester, New Hampshire, in the United States. The church was founded to serve the needs of French-Canadian Catholic immigrants to New Hampshire. Ste. Marie Church is situated 1½ miles east of Comiskey Center (Fine Arts).

West Side
Suburb
The West Side is a large area defining many neighborhoods in the city of Manchester, New Hampshire, in the United States. It consists of all parts of the city that lie west of the Merrimack River and includes the neighborhoods of Northwest Manchester, Rimmon Heights, Notre Dame, Piscataquog, Wolfe Park, and Mast Road.
